U pause is a rental cottage with a natural hot spring.
The lovely crimson red exterior with white lines catches the eye even in Zao Sansui-en, where many villas stand side by side, making you feel like you are at a resort.
Upon entering the cottage, guests are welcomed by the high vaulted ceiling and open living room. The loft-like structure is exciting. The Japanese taste interior and wooden interior harmonize to create a calm and warm feeling inside. From the window, you can see the seasonal scenery of Zao. #About the accommodation plan
"U pause" is a private lodge for up to 9 people, limited to one group per day. The room rate is the same for up to 4 people, with an additional charge for each additional person from 5 people.
Meals are not included in the room rate.
The room rate is the same for up to 4 people.
# About the rooms
On the first floor, there is a living room, a Japanese-style room that can be used as a bedroom, a kitchen, and a bath. The kitchen can be used for cooking during your stay. Tableware and minimal cooking tools are provided. (*We do not provide seasonings. Please bring your own. The bath is of course a natural hot spring. The bath is of course a natural hot spring, and you can enjoy it whenever you like.
On the second floor, there is a Japanese-style room and a Western-style room.
The second floor has one Japanese-style room and one Western-style room, with four futon bedding sets in the Japanese-style room and two single beds in the Western-style room, which can be used as bedrooms.

About Zao Sansuien
U pause is located on the grounds of Zao Sansui-en, a villa overlooking the Zao mountain range, and is fully managed for your peace of mind. There is also a tennis court on the Sansui-en grounds and a swimming pool in the summer. (*This is also available for guests staying at our facility!
The hotel is located near Togatta Onsen, a hot spring resort, so you can enjoy the hot spring as well. A short drive from the inn, there is the popular "Fox Village" where you can meet fluffy foxes, and "Kami no Yu" where you can enjoy day trip bathing at a reasonable price.
The Matsukawa River flows through the park, and you can take a walk along the riverbank while enjoying the view of the Zao Mountain Range. The stream, which was the origin of the name "Seseragi-no-Sato" (village of murmuring fireflies), runs through the park and remains so pure that fireflies can live there. The park is filled with the colors of the four seasons: spring with fresh greenery, summer with green leaves, autumn with red leaves, and winter with silvery white leaves. The park is full of nature, with trees, flowers, and flowering plants adding color to the seasons. The garden is also home to many wild birds.
